Is this trip right for you?
verified
Less time spent travelling, more time to explore each destination. The primary means of transportation on this trip is by train. Trains are a fast way to cross long distances, allowing you to avoid traffic jams and arrive right into the city centre. They are comfortable and all have toilets, however, can sometimes be quite busy. Please note that you'll have to carry your own luggage on and off the train, so make sure it doesn’t exceed our weight and size recommendations. You can find specifics under ‘Packing’ in the ‘Essential Trip Information’ section.
verified
Europe is steeped in old buildings, and often there are no lifts or escalators, particularly in some train stations or hotels. You may have to carry your bags up and down stairs, but the trek will be worth it.
verified
Don’t let the heat keep you from exploring the world! Summer temperatures can be very high (over 40°C), which can make things uncomfortable. It’s important to use sun protection, wear layers to combat the heat, and drink plenty of water.
verified
Hotels in Europe often don't have double beds, but rather two single beds that can be pushed together. In some cases, bathroom facilities will be shared rather than ensuite.
verified
On this trip you must pack as lightly as possible because you will be expected to carry your own bag and although you won't be required to walk long distances with your luggage (max 30 minutes), we strongly recommend keeping the weight under 15 kg (33 lb). Most travellers carry their luggage in a backpack or suitcase, although an overnight bag with a shoulder strap would suffice if you travel lightly. Smaller bags or backpacks with wheels are convenient although we recommend your bag has carry straps to accommodate the cobbled streets, uneven surfaces, stairs and steps you are likely to encounter while carrying your luggage. You'll also need a day pack/bag for daytrips.

Itinerary
From la vida loca to la dolce vita, enjoy a slice of the good life from Barcelona to Rome
Lose yourself in three of Europe's most enchanting countries on this 15-day adventure from Barcelona to Rome. Arrive in the vibrant streets of Barcelona, then travel into the heart of the Spanish Pyrenees. Discover Provencal food and world-class wines as you frolic with Europe’s high rollers in the French Riviera, then feast on breathtaking sights in the cliff-top towns of the Cinque Terre. See master works of art in Florence and get your iconic pic at the leaning Torre de Pisa. Call into beautiful Siena before ending it all in the ancient city of Rome.
